faith plus self-control
The third thing Peter said we must add to our faith is self-control. The Greek term translated self-control is defined as “power or lordship…over oneself or over something.” It connotes the idea of mastering something so that it is brought under your subjection. In this lesson, we’ll consider why adding self-control is not optional or personal. Additionally, we’ll look at what the Bible says it entails.
